Sheltered housing

Sheltered housing is designed to meet the needs of older people who are seeking a home for independent living into their retirement.

Who qualifies

Sheltered housing is for people aged 67 and over. You may also qualify if you are over 55 and have a proven need to live in sheltered housing, for example you have a disability or certain medical conditions. 

There is no upper age limit, and most tenants are active and independent.

Sheltered Housing is available to people over who are:

  • Croydon council or housing association tenants
  • tenants of a private landlord
  • a qualifying owner-occupier
  • able to live independently with no or few care needs

If you are a couple and only one partner is over 67, you may qualify if there is not a large age gap.
